Auto to T56 Swappers: Did you change your chip?

I am about to do the swap and I have heard conflicting stories on how it will run with the stock auto chip in it. What did you guys do and how does it run?

At first I ran my auto-trans chip and it worked fairly well, only bad thing was the idle speed while moving and in neutral or w/ the clutch in. The AUJP code wanted to hold the idle speed at ~1200rpm while the car was moving...I could see it on my scanner, desired idle RPM was ~1200rpm. As soon as I came to a stop, it would drop down to 750rpm.

I changed to code for a '91 Vette with ZF6 trans and the behavior stopped, it now snaps right down to 750rpm when I drop out of gear and coast.

I changed my chip. I have the equipment to customize and burn chips so it was no big deal.

But if I didn't have the equipment or money I would at least get a memcal (chip) from the dealer of a car that did have a manual trans and had the same engine, unless you have a 350, in which case you aren't going to find one.

I burned a chip myself using the Vette binary as a starting point, copying in my previous VE and spark table data.

Check the diy-prom forum and TRAXXION's article at the top of the message list to get started on your own.
